My opinion: I really liked the Morrowind music, but I think that this stuff is much better. The music in Morrowind was a little bit repetitive and contained to much brass in many places. The Oblivion stuff has a wider variety of instuments in more places, which makes for better harmony and themes. This game just keeps getting better and better! goodjob.gif

Some of the tracks are really similar. I might copy some of the morrowind music over too for some variety.

Through the Valley" song number 2 made me really nostalgic to morrowind though, because a morrowind wandering song sounds a lot like that. The difference is the oblivion song seems like it's sharp, better composed, and just more appealing. The composition also feels like I could paint a picture in my head of a guy exploring through the forest collecting herbs and shooting deer.
